In GTA V's base movement mechanics, players can dodge or jump to the side. A strafe macro automates this "glitch roll" or "strafing" technique—essentially spamming directional keys combined with a crouch or dodge command at precise intervals, often creating a "teleporting" visual effect for opposing players.
While a strafe macro for FiveM is a powerful tool for manipulating character movement, the risks of being banned far outweigh the benefits. As servers become more adept at detecting automated movement, relying on these scripts is a quick way to lose your access to top-tier roleplay communities.
